There are two views with regard to this particular section. One is that Valluvar gives expression to purely Tamil aspect of Kama (sexual desire). ![]() According to this whole can be conveniently divided into Kalaviyal and Karpiyal, and these again are based on the five tinais peculiar to the Tamils.īut the celebrated commentator of the Kural, Parimel azagarwould again find correspondences between this subject of the subject and that in Sanskrit literature. In the Karpiyal section again Parimelaalagar would find corresponding terms for the different incidents like According to that authority, Kalaviyal and Karpiyal correspond to the Samyoga and Vipralambha of the KAMASUTRA treatises. The Sanskritists add the fifth incident Saapa.Īs this is quite uncommon, says the commentator, Valluvar did not include it in his treatment of the subject.
